Martin Garrix and Third Party Release Stunning Progressive House Anthem, "Carry You"

If you thought progressive house was dead, think again.

Martin Garrix and Third Party have finally dropped “Carry You,” a hotly anticipated progressive house song featuring Oaks and Declan J Donovan. Garrix debuted the vintage track live in his Ultra Music Festival 2023 set and it became an instant classic as his fans clamored for an official release.

It’s an unforgettable record and a big moment for fans of both Garrix and Third Party, whose soaring production transports us to a place where burdens dissolve. The blissed-out track shimmers with pulsing synths and sky-high vocals, which function as an unswerving promise that even when shadows swallow the sun, you won’t walk alone.

Oaks and Donovan help deliver an anthem of hope in “Carry You,” their powerful lyricism painting its arrangement with the bright colors of resilience. Together with Garrix and Third Party, they throw a neon-drenched lifeline to anyone whose world is crumbling around them.

“This world can be a really cruel and lonely place sometimes,” Oaks said. “I know how it feels trying to find your way with an unbearable weight on your shoulders. That’s why I love ‘Carry You’ so much, because it feels like a warm hug to me. It makes me think of all the beautiful people that helped me through the darkness, all the shoulders that held up my world. This song reminds me of how safe you can feel in someone’s arms and how, with only their presence, they can make you forget about your pain for a moment.”

“Carry You” is out now on Garrix’s STMPD RCRDS. You can listen to the new single and its instrumental mix below.
